Community Garden update

Below is a photo of the proposed area for the community garden. You can see the area outlined in pink of course. The area inside the sidewalks is 120' x 60'. I am told there is already water available there so that would make life a bit easier.
The location is nice. It is close to the center of the Belle Creek Community and being just off Hwy 85 (you can see on the right side of the photo) it is easily accessible. Parking isn't too bad because there are two large parking lots just one block away.

One of the concerns from the community board is the appearance. What will the garden look like when it is up and working? Of course they want it to be as eye-catching as possible. If anyone out there is into landscaping perhaps we can take some suggestions - how would you design this garden?

Going Green

So, I just met with a gentleman about "100% biodegradable and/or compostable consumable plastics" and possibly using them at farmers markets. In the past I have had market owners ask if we could provide them with a "green" solution to the plastic bags currently being used at the markets.

One solution is of course to provide them with canvas bags or something like that. One issue with that is the cost - the material bags are expensive and most markets expect to be reimbursed for thier cost by selling them to the customers that visit their markets. Unfortunately, that has not caught on and any large scale as of yet. People are going to use plastic bags; the vendors, the customers, etc. because they are still cheap and easy.

Perhaps useing the biodegradable and/or compostable materials are an alternative. A market could still go green by using these items. They would pay more than using regular plastic but considerably less than using canvas or other materials.

I will talk to some of the market owners and get a feel for what they want and see if they believe it would be worth there time and money. But folks, we have to face the facts, we can't afford to keep using the products we have grown accustomed to. We are going to have to change and stop ignoring the problems.
